Images from the Spitzer space telescope have just been released, these are coloured infra red images and are really massive.  The images total to about 5 GIGApixels in size
and you can download each piece from here.

http://www.spitzer.caltech.edu/Media/releases/ssc2008-11/ssc2008-11b.shtml

Each piece is 50 - 80mb in the best JPG format.

I've just finished downloading the very middle piece with the blue and it looks bloody awesome :)  Be careful although they are small jpg files they do take about 1gb of ram to actually open into memory.
